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2129186280 307 323 24637214011
90243116538 2799799783 59287155
90243116538 2799799783 59287155
56225 407 9587016991 129350197
All about undefined
Interested in learning more?
90243116538 2799799783 59287155
56225 407 9587016991 129350197
See more
124202877 91244 525519863
33 6481803 62
See more
6998014 265 262
2568265 82553137 42918087
See more